These Chocolate Ganache Brownies feature a fudgy, rich base layered with smooth, glossy ganache — a decadent dessert that melts in your mouth with every bite.
Brownie Layer:
1/2 cup unsalted butter, melted
1/2 cup granulated sugar
1/4 cup brown sugar
2 large eggs
1 tsp vanilla extract
1/2 cup unsweetened cocoa powder
1/2 cup all-purpose flour
1/4 tsp salt
1/2 cup chocolate chips (optional)
Ganache:
4 oz semi-sweet chocolate (chopped or chips)
1/2 cup heavy cream
1 tbsp butter (optional)
Preheat oven to 325°F. Line and grease an 8×8-inch pan.
Whisk butter and sugars. Add eggs and vanilla. Mix well.
Stir in cocoa powder, flour, and salt. Fold in chocolate chips if using.
Spread into pan and bake for 28–32 minutes. Cool completely.
For ganache: heat cream until simmering, pour over chocolate, and let sit 2–3 mins. Stir smooth. Add butter for shine.
Pour ganache over cooled brownies. Smooth and chill for 1–2 hours.
Slice with warm knife for clean edges. Serve at room temperature.
Store in fridge for up to 5 days or freeze.
Add sea salt, espresso, or mint for flavor variations.
